Output 825000317b849f7610e89a4d8af8d042a49e2b2d65fb11d108154518439bb00e:1

value
23665
script pubkey
OP_0 OP_PUSHBYTES_20 85d3ad278614b81fd9231ff0f5ad8e87220712c6
address
ltc1qshf66fuxzjuplkfrrlc0ttvwsu3qwykxws2xeq
transaction
825000317b849f7610e89a4d8af8d042a49e2b2d65fb11d108154518439bb00e
spent
true